What happens if you dont license your dog in Maricopa County?
Licensing penalties: Late fees accrue every 30 days at a rate of $3 a month for an altered dog and $6 a month for an unaltered dog. Unaltered/intact dogs under 1 year of age are charged $55 for their initial licensing, and once altered, they will be eligible for the $22 renewal rate the following year.
How many dogs can you have in Maricopa AZ?
Household Pets. In all zoning districts except rural districts, a maximum of four dogs is allowed. These limitations do not apply to small animals kept within a residence, including cats, fish, small birds, rodents, and reptiles.
Do you need a kennel license in Arizona?
Pursuant to Arizona statute and county ordinance, a person must obtain a kennel permit issued by the Board of Supervisors if the person operates a kennel in which there are five or more dogs which are not individually licensed.
